To strengthen women empowerment in the business sphere, both Central and State governments have launched a financial constituent to uplift women entrepreneurship in India.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<div class=\"read\"><p><b>Also, Read:<\/b> <mark><a href=\"https:\/\/enterslice.com\/learning\/msme-registration-process\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Detail Explanation about MSME Registration Process &amp; Who Need to Register?<\/a><\/mark>.<\/p><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">MSME Schemes For Empowering Women Entrepreneurs<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Trade-Related Entrepreneurship Assistance and Development (TREAD)<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Women have been among the oppressed section of our country in many spheres of life.&nbsp; The government launched a scheme titled Trade Related Entrepreneurship Assistance and Development (TREAD) which aims at the economic empowerment of women. As per this scheme, the government grants up to 30% of the total project cost as decided by the lending institutions which finance the rest 70% as a loan to the applicant women. Women who are illiterate, poor and are not able to provide adequate security as demanded by the bank, government grant and the loan provided the lending institutions is routed through <a href=\"https:\/\/enterslice.com\/ngo-registration\">NGOs<\/a> engaged in helping poor women. The government also grants up to Rs 1 lakh per program to training institutions and NGOs for giving training to women entrepreneurs.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Mahila Coir Yojna<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>This scheme launched by the government is a women-oriented employment scheme in the coir industry, to provide employment opportunities to rural women artisans. Under this scheme, motorized rats are distributed for spinning coir yarns to women artisans. Women spinners are trained for about two months in the spinning coir Board. The spinning coir Board also gives subsidy on traditional motorized rats.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">MSME &nbsp;Schemes Offered by Banks to\nWomen Entrepreneurs<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Schemes offered by State Bank of Mysore<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>This bank offers two schemes to women entrepreneurs, namely\nAnnapurna Scheme and Stree Shakti Scheme.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Annapurna Scheme<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>This scheme was launched by the bank to help women who want to start food catering units. Banks offer a loan up to Rs 50,000 to women wishing to start a food catering business. The loan provided by the bank can be used for buying kitchen utensils, gas connections, and other business-related expenses. The repayment period for this loan provided by SBM is 3 years.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Stree Shakti<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>The State Bank of Mysore offers this loan to women who have undergone an Entrepreneurship Development Programme (EDP) training. EDP training may extend up to 6-8 weeks which aims at planning, initiating and launching an enterprise successfully. Under this scheme, the bank offers a loan up to Rs 50 lakhs.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Punjab National Bank<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>PNB offers 5 schemes for women entrepreneurs. Different\nschemes offered by PNB are as follows: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Mahila Samridhi Yojna<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>This scheme launched by <a href=\"https:\/\/www.pnbindia.in\/\">PNB<\/a> provides financial assistance to women who wish to open a boutique, beauty parlors, cyber cafes, telephone booths, etc.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Mahila Udyam Nidhi Scheme<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>This scheme of Punjab National Bank supports women who wish to start a new small-scale venture. Under this scheme, the women entrepreneurs are assisted in setting up new projects in the small scale sector. Already existing small scale industrial units undertaking technology up-gradation can also benefit from the scheme.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Mahila Saashaktikaran Abhiyan<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>This scheme of Punjab National Bank provides financial assistance to women who intend to establish a small and micro-enterprise in the non- farm sector.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Syndicate Bank<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>To cater to women entrepreneurs\nSyndicate bank launched a scheme named Synd Mahila Shakti. This scheme launched\nby the Syndicate bank targets both new and current women entrepreneurs. This\nscheme offers cash credit to meet the working capital requirement or a loan\nscheme up to a time period of ten years. Any business seeking this loan should\nhave women owning 50% of the financial holding.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Conclusion<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>The women have achieved immense success over the years in changing the perception of a male-dominated society.
